Pricing and Artist Commission Structure

Being not for profit, we’re not like most other businesses. We sell your work to put money in your pockets, not ours, and we want to make sure we sell as much as possible.

We apply a pricing approach that protects the artist’s sale return, whilst allowing us to set prices to a level we believe is appropriate for your product and flex them if necessary to maximise sales opportunity.

So how does it work?

1)    You work out your cost to produce and add on the profit you want to make.  This is your sale return.

2)    We discuss this with you in terms of the likely price point your work is likely to achieve.  There may be some negotiation at this stage if we think it’s a product we couldn’t sell at a price point above the return you require, but in the majority of cases the return you want will be the one we agree to.

3)    That figure we agree with you is fixed and it’s down to WaB to determine what we think is an achievable sale price.  So if you agree a sale return of £15 for a piece and we sell the item for £40, you get £15. If we sell it for £30 you get £15. If we sell it for £15.01p, you get £15.

What this gives us is the flexibility to change price points of items to hit a realistic sale value, thus increasing the chance of your items being sold.

For example, a customer comes into the shop and says “I like that picture but at £80 it’s a bit too pricey for me.” With our flexible  pricing approach, we might offer to discount the sale price to £70 which could lead to the customer making a purchase.  It doesn’t affect the amount you would get from the successful sale, that is fixed.

We eat into our profit margins to make the sale, not yours.
